Best known for being aprofessional rugby union playerfor theEnglandinternational team and for the national team,Leicester Tigers, Julian WhiteMBEis regarded as one of the most powerful forwards and props in the game. Starting off his sports career as an apprentice withOkehamptonandPlymouth Albion, Julian had the opportunity to play in New Zealand forHawke’s BayandCenterbury Crusaders.
It was after his return from New Zealand that Julian moved toBridgendin 1998, before moving to the prestigiousSaracensin 1999. It was in 2000 that Julian White was called up to make hisEnglanddebut. Julian has had anextremely successful rugby careerthat spanned over 20 years.
He was part of the2003 World Cupwinning team that triumphed over Australia, and won the2001 Six Nationswith thegrand slam winning England squad. Furthermore, he also won multiple trophies with the Leicester Tigers team, before retiring from the sport. As a result of his contribution to the sport, Julian was appointedMBEin 2004.
